English meaning
Senses
asentir is used for these senses in English:
- agree (intransitive) To make a stipulation by way of settling differences or determining a price; to exchange promises; to come to terms or to a common resolve; to promise.
- assent (intransitive) To agree to a proposal.
- nod (ambitransitive) To incline the head up and down, as to indicate agreement.
- stipulate (US, transitive, formal, law) To acknowledge the truth of; not to challenge.
